<H4><A NAME="4.24">4.24</A>) How do I do an <i>outer</i> join?<BR></H4><P>
|
||||||
|
PostgreSQL does not support outer joins in the current release. They can
|
||||||
|
be simulated using <small>UNION</small> and <small>NOT IN</small>. For
|
||||||
|
example, when joining <i>tab1</i> and <i>tab2,</i> the following query
|
||||||
|
does an <i>outer</i> join of the two tables:
|
||||||
|
<PRE>
|
||||||
|
SELECT tab1.col1, tab2.col2
|
||||||
|
FROM tab1, tab2
|
||||||
|
WHERE tab1.col1 = tab2.col1
|
||||||
|
UNION ALL
|
||||||
|
SELECT tab1.col1, NULL
|
||||||
|
FROM tab1
|
||||||
|
WHERE tab1.col1 NOT IN (SELECT tab2.col1 FROM tab2)
|
||||||
|
ORDER BY tab1.col1
|
||||||
|
</PRE>
